PROCEDURE

实验过程

4.3 g (17 mmol) of 4-bromodiphenylamine, 5 g (17 mmol) of triphenylamine-4-boronic acid, and 532 mg of tri(o-tolyl)phosphine were put into a 500 mL three-neck flask, and the atmosphere in the flask was substituted by nitrogen. 60 mL of toluene, 40 mL of ethanol, and 14 ml of a potassium carbonate aqueous solution (0.2 mol/L) were added into this mixture. The mixture was deaerated while being stirred under reduced pressure, and after deaeration, 75 mg (0.35 mmol) of palladium(II) acetate was added. This mixture was refluxed at 100° C. for 10.5 hours. An aqueous layer of the mixture was extracted with toluene. The extracted solution and an organic layer were washed together with saturated brine, and magnesium sulfate was added thereto for drying. This mixture was filtrated and the filtrate was concentrated to obtain an oily light-brown substance. The oily substance was dissolved in about 50 mL of toluene, and was subjected to suction filtration through Celite (manufactured by Celite Co., Ltd.), alumina, and Florisil (manufactured by Floridin Company). A solid substance obtained by concentrating the filtrate was purified by a silica gel column chromatography (developing solvent was a mixed solvent of hexane:toluene=4:6) to obtain a white solid substance. The obtained white solid substance was recrystallized with chloroform/hexane, so that 3.5 g of an white substance was obtained in yield 49%.
